Now as for the hardware:
First of all, for the price of the Amiga One. Have you actaully sat down and made a price analasys of it? A PPC chip from Arrows, for example, will set you back about $250 + VAT and shipping, a MegArray connector, another $250 + VAT and shipping. Fortunately, these are by far the two most expensive bits.
Secondly, there are mini-ITX formfactor Amigas sold today wich are produced on a batch for batch basis.
